Hi, 

I was wondering if there is a way to show the non-editable Activity ID as column on P6? (Similar to MS Project where the Unique ID is not editable)

This allows me to undertake analytics, track changes of the user defined fields.

Alternatively is there a way to lock the activity ID so it is not editable?

If you are using P6 standalone, you cannot locked the activity id. If you are using the Professional enterprise or EPPM version and you have admin right, you can change the users Project security profile not to have priviledge editing the Activity ID.
